Product's Label Information
Ingredients from packaging:
Silica, Aloe Vera (Aloe Barbadensis) Leaf Juice, Fragrance
Directions from packaging:
Before Using: Read enclosed directions carefully and completely. Facial Buffer: Separate pink Facial Strip from its protective backing and adhere to purple Support. With one hand, pull skin back, keep it smooth and taut, while gently stroking the Hair Off Facial Buffer over skin in a clockwise and counterclockwise motion. After removing all unwanted hair, wash your face with cold water and apply mild cream if necessary. Also good for touch ups between hair removals. Avoid getting the SiliCoat strip wet. Body Mitten: With hand inside Mitten, Gently massage a small area of skin. Alternate between clockwise and counterclockwise motions without lifting the Mitten off the skin. Leaves legs hair-free and silky smooth. One Mitten removes hair from both legs 1-2 times depending on hair thickness
Warnings from packaging:
Facial Buffer:Excessive rubbing may cause abrasions to the skin. Please use carefully. Do not use near eyes. Do not use rashes, irritations, sunburn, peeling or broken skin. If irritation occurs discontinue use. Keep away from children. Body Mitten:Excessive rubbing may cause abrasions to the skin. Please use carefully. Do not stroke up and down or apply too much pressure. Do not use near eyes. Do not use over rashes, irritations, sunburn, peeling or broken skin. If irritation occurs discontinue use. Keep away from children.
ABOUT THE SKIN DEEP® RATINGS
EWG provides information on personal care product ingredients from the published scientific literature, to supplement incomplete data available from companies and the government. The ratings below indicate the relative level of concern posed by exposure to the ingredients in this product - not the product itself - compared to other product formulations. The ratings reflect potential health hazards but do not account for the level of exposure or individual susceptibility, factors which determine actual health risks, if any.
